About Office of the Project Director, Integrated Tribal Development Project, Udalguri

The Integrated Tribal Development Project (ITDP), Udalguri, operating under the Government of Assam, is focused on the smooth functioning of the District Level FRA Cell. This recruitment is part of its ongoing efforts in rural development and tribal welfare.

Job Posts

Co-ordinator (FRA)MIS/Program (FRA)/Associate FRA

Eligibility Criteria

Educational Qualification

  • For Co-ordinator (FRA): Master's Degree in Social Science or Social Work. Additionally, knowledge of basic IT/Computer applications with a minimum one-year diploma from a reputed institute is required.
  • For MIS/Program (FRA)/Associate FRA: Bachelor's Degree (B.Sc/BA) in Statistics, Mathematics, Economics, or Social Science from a reputed institution. Additionally, a minimum one-year diploma in Information Technology (IT) or Computer Applications from a reputed institute is mandatory.

Age Limit Details

Candidates must be a minimum of 18 years old and not exceed 35 years of age. No age relaxations are explicitly mentioned in the notification.

Check Your Age Eligibility

Salary & Pay Scale

  • Co-ordinator (FRA): Rs. 35,000/- per month
  • MIS/Program (FRA)/Associate FRA: Rs. 25,000/- per month

The selected candidates will be engaged on a purely contractual basis for an initial period of 11 months, with potential for renewal for another 11 months based on satisfactory performance.

How to Apply

  • A Walk-in Interview will be conducted on 16th January 2026.
  • Candidates must attend for registration at the District Commissioner office campus/Premises, Udalguri, between 9:30 AM to 11:30 AM on the interview date.
  • Applicants must bring all requisite original documents for verification during registration.
  • No candidate will be permitted to register after 11:30 AM on 16th January 2026.
  • No Travelling Allowance (TA) or Daily Allowance (DA) will be admissible for attending the interview.
